Etymology

edit

From burglarous +‎ -ly.

Adverb

edit

burglarously (comparative more burglarously, superlative most burglarously)

  1. (crime) In a burglarous manner.
    • 1996, Barbara Bernard, Scott Michael Long, Burning roses[1]:
      And about the hour of ten o'clock at night the same day, they did feloniously and burglarously break and enter with the intent to steal the goods and chattel of Hendrix []
